Significado de You're not worthy of his accomplishments
Not deserving of respect or recognition for achievements.
In simple words: You do not deserve his achievements.
You're not worthy of his accomplishments em uma frase
- You're not worthy of his accomplishments if you haven't put in the effort.
- Her attitude makes it clear that she feels you're not worthy of his accomplishments.
- If you continuously lie, you're not worthy of his accomplishments.
- Actions speak louder; if you don't help, you're not worthy of his accomplishments.
- Don't act surprised; you're not worthy of his accomplishments if you don't value teamwork.
Como usar You're not worthy of his accomplishments
Used to express that someone does not meet the required standards for recognition or respect. It can carry a negative connotation and should be used carefully.

Common mistakes with You're not worthy of his accomplishments
- Confusing 'worthy' with 'worth it', which has a different meaning.
- Using 'worthy' incorrectly in context, such as saying 'worthy for' instead of 'worthy of'.
